Front End Developer
Our client is a multi-award-winning, leading Digital Marketing agency based In London and require a Front-End Developer, working remotely, to provide support to the development team and other marketing departments.
You will be working with a broad range of CMS platforms across a range of projects and will help departments to achieve their campaign successes with quick turnaround times and well-communicated output.
We would love to hear from you if:
- You enjoy maintaining and modifying websites
- Have knowledge of various CMS platforms and frameworks, such as WordPress, Shopify, Joomla, Magento, Lavarel and Drupal
- Experience using and implementing Google Analytics, Search Console, Tag Manager and other tracking tools
- Have experience writing custom HTML, CSS, and JavaScript.
- Expertise in writing semantic, modular front-end code using HTML5, CSS3, and W3C coding practices
- Experience with Front end frameworks such as Bootstrap desirable
- Possess a strong attention to detail
- Ability to prioritise tasks and remain adaptable to changing priorities based on client and internal demand.
Overview of the Front-End Developer role:
- Provide support to the development team
- Supporting the development team with website launches and migrations (redirect strategies, content migration, crawl-budget optimisation).
- liaise with marketing departments across all areas of technical SEO, landing page building, and custom coding web pages and functionalities.
- Working with a broad range of CMS platforms across a range of projects
- Support departments to achieve their campaign successes with quick turnaround times and well-communicated output
- Resolve technical SEO issues for websites.
- Support the SEO, PPC, Content and PR team for content upload and formatting for different CMS platform.
- Support SEO and PPC department with Ecommerce tracking setup/troubleshooting.
- liaise directly with clients where required, and to professionally handle client feedback.
- The ability to provide accurate estimates for tasks and timescales.
